ACEVEDO v. LAYTON


131 Misc.2d 406 (1985)

Isidoro Acevedo, Appellant, v. Barbara Layton, Respondent.

Supreme Court, Appellate Term, Second Department.

October 7, 1985


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Farley, Jutkowitz, Balint & Wiederkehr (Alfred E. Donnellan of counsel), for appellant. James O. Hivnor and Ray A. Jones for respondent.

DI PAOLA, P. J., SLIFKIN and STARK, JJ., concur.


MEMORANDUM.

Appeal dismissed.

In the absence of the entry of a final judgment upon the subject order, no appeal will lie (see, UCCA 1702).

Were the matter properly before us, we would be inclined to affirm.
